Vitajte na [www.pocitac.win] Pripojiť k domovskej stránke Obľúbené stránky

Domáce Hardware Siete Programovanie Softvér Otázka Systémy

Ako si vyrobiť vzor v C + + kód

Rovnako ako pletenie vzory , programovacie vzory sú nástroje pre duplikovanie dobrý dizajn . Douglas Schmidt z Vanderbilt University opisuje , C + + vzory , ako spôsob , ako zachytiť úspešné riešenie konkrétnych programovacích problémov , takže programátori môžu znovu použiť riešenie neskôr . Štrukturálne vzory popisujú , ako organizovať a pripojiť objekty . Behaviorálna vzory zachytiť spôsoby , ako organizovať kód . Vzory pre tvorbu záznam metódy organizovať kód pre vytvorenie softvérové ​​objekty . Tieto skupiny majú ďalšie pododdelenia : Faktor vzory , napríklad vytvoriť zovšeobecnené softvérové ​​objekty - programové komponenty - skôr než predmety na mieru na konkrétne problémy . Pokyny dovolená 1

Definujte účel vzoru a problém , ktorý chcete riešiť . Vanderbilt je Schmidt odporúča on - line , ktoré môžete definovať problém vo všeobecnej rovine : Úspešné modely majú existenciu nezávislú na tom , ako ich užívatelia vykonávať v konkrétnych situáciách . Vzory sú dobrým riešením pre opakujúce sa problémy skôr než jedinečnej udalosti .
2

zoznamu požiadaviek , alebo sily , ktoré budú pôsobiť na vzorku . Ak ste kód softvéru pre akciové citátom služby , napríklad sily zahŕňajú viac investorov kontroly trhu , z ktorých každý má iný pohľad a záujem . Úspešný model poskytuje užitočné informácie bez ohľadu na to , ako jednotlivé pozorovateľov a ich potreby zmeniť .
3

Navrhnúť štruktúru vzoru je , abstraktné , grafické znázornenie toho , čo chcete robiť . Identifikovať softvérové ​​objekty pre vzor zamestnávať v napĺňaní svojho cieľa , akú úlohu každý objekt je , a ako objekty spolupracujú spolu
4

identifikovať pozitívne a negatívne dôsledky prijatia vašej navrhovanej vzor .. Ak váš model umožňuje použiť úspešné riešenie rýchlo celú triedu opakujúcich sa problémov , to je plus , napríklad . Negatívne môže byť , že je to menej efektívne než riešenia šité na mieru každému jednotlivému problému .
5

Napíšte kód pre vytvorenie svojho vzoru . Otestujte ho , akonáhle dokončíte uistiť , že všetko funguje tak , ako chcete .

Najnovšie články

Copyright © počítačové znalosti Všetky práva vyhradené